Meaning of bosser | Babel Free

Noun CEFR B1

Definitions

  1. A bossy person, one who orders others around.
  2. A large marble in children's games.
  3. An instrument used to push clay into a mold.

Examples

“They were all bossers here. Especially the women. They were bossy even when they deared her.”
“[…] the ultimate winner is the man with the greatest number of marbles when play comes to an end. The games at Battle at the present time are played with glass marbles and locally made “bossers” of concrete.”
“Modern children, having only machine-made glass marbles, are restricted to names describing their size, or the names under which they are sold, or fanciful names of their own inventing. Thus big marbles are big 'uns, bossers, bulls or bullies[…]”
